Transaction 15876085e5ddd9ba04ce85f5731810df031122b027960d69611978264a67edb4

1 Input
2 Outputs
  • 15876085e5ddd9ba04ce85f5731810df031122b027960d69611978264a67edb4:0
  • value  41685168
    address  bc1qqg7673m7hd9xrnuufra5mmukq3rz33wdrwkc3n
  • 15876085e5ddd9ba04ce85f5731810df031122b027960d69611978264a67edb4:1
  • value  6837359
    address  32efswYsLZGrNrwbU5Lr2LKo2kaUmXX5JJ